    That tank is too small for any Tang or Trigger, and if you want to eventually get corals an angel may not be the way to go. A kole is small and can live in a 55 if they must, but be sure to have an established tank with plenty of algae (ie not a freshly cycled tank, give it about 6more months). I've considered having one, but I decided that I couldnt keep a large active fish in a small tank.
    A second Pink skunk would be a good addition (smaller than the first one)
    I would vote for about 40 more lbs of rock, a nice jawfish, a 2nd pink skunk and maybe a wrasse (JMO) but that'd be about your limit.
